How to Maintain Sexual Confidence While Exploring Unconventional Desires?

If you're looking to explore your sexuality beyond traditional norms, it can be nerve-wracking to tell your partner about your unconventional desires. However, there are several ways to boost your self-confidence and communicate effectively with your partner to create an atmosphere of trust and openness. Here's how:

1. Set the Stage for Discussion

Start by setting the stage for an open and honest discussion with your partner. Ensure that they feel comfortable discussing any aspect of their sexuality, including taboo topics. This will help them feel more comfortable sharing what they want without fear of judgment. Encourage them to share their own desires and preferences so that you both have a better understanding of each other's boundaries.

2. Choose Your Words Carefully

When communicating your desires, choose language that is specific and avoids vague or ambiguous terms. For example, instead of saying "I like bondage," say something like "I enjoy being tied up." It's also essential to acknowledge your partner's feelings and needs. Express your desire in a way that respects their boundaries, and don't pressure them into anything they aren't comfortable with. Be prepared for rejection, but remember that not all partners are willing to engage in every type of sex play.

3. Keep Things Consensual

Remember that consent is crucial at all times during sex. If your partner doesn't want to try out certain activities, honor their wishes. Never use coercion or manipulation to get them to do something against their will. Instead, focus on finding mutually pleasurable activities that bring you both excitement. You can explore different types of foreplay, role-playing scenarios, or BDSM scenes while keeping things consensual.

4. Practice Self-Love

It's crucial to practice self-love and acceptance before attempting to communicate your unconventional desires with your partner. Start by exploring yourself through masturbation or solo sexual activity. This helps you become familiar with your body and desires and builds confidence in your ability to express what turns you on. Don't be afraid to experiment, as long as it feels safe and consensual.

5. Find Community Support

Finding community support can help you feel more confident about exploring your sexuality. Seek out groups or communities online or in person where people share similar interests. These groups can provide valuable insights and resources, including how-to guides and tips from others who have gone down the same path. It's also essential to connect with like-minded individuals who respect boundaries and consent.

6. Take Things Slowly

Don't rush into anything too quickly when trying new things together. Experiment with small steps first, such as introducing a toy or trying a different position. This allows you both to learn and grow at your own pace without feeling overwhelmed. Remember to check in regularly throughout the experience to ensure that everything remains consensual and enjoyable for both partners.

7. Respect Your Partner's Feelings

Ultimately, remember to respect your partner's feelings and needs during sex. Be open to listening to them and taking their feedback seriously. If something doesn't feel right, don't push it. Instead, focus on finding activities that bring mutual pleasure and intimacy. By following these tips, you can maintain sexual confidence while exploring unconventional desires with your partner.
